Three former Michigan State University football players who are facing sexual assault charges stemming from a January incident are expected to be in court Friday morning.

Josh King, Donnie Corley, and Demetric Vance have a pre-exam conference set for 8:30 a.m. in East Lansing District court.

TIMELINE: Former MSU football players face sex assault charges

The preliminary hearing is when the judge decides if there's enough evidence to send them to trial, that is scheduled for Thursday, September 21.
